August 2023 Bay Area Radio PPM Ratings

Here are the August 2023 San Francisco Radio PPM Ratings:


And the August 2023 San Jose Radio PPM Ratings:

Covering the survey period from Thu. 7/20/2023 thru Wed. 8/16/2023, age 6+ overall alternate view:


Top 5+ demo rankings analysis by Research Director Inc. is posted on their own "Hot Topics" blog page.

Press release:


Blog page: RADIO RATINGS ROUNDUP AUGUST 2023, PART 1 | Research Director, Inc.

(scroll down to see San Francisco)

25-54: 1. KOIT 2. KMVQ 3. KMEL 4. KISQ 5. KRZZ (up from #8) 9. KOSF (down from #5)
18-34: 1. KOIT 2. KMEL 3. KMVQ 4. KQED (up from #9) 5T. KISQ 5T. KYLD 5T. KITS
18-49: 1. KOIT 2. KMVQ 3. KMEL 4. KISQ 5. KQED (up from #10) 11. KIOI (down from #5)

KYLD and KRBQ continue their decline, interesting. Pretty standard fair for everyone else. Off season for KGMZ, the normal “offenders” at the top (KCBS, KOIT, KQED)

I kind of wonder what iHeart is gonna do about 94.9.
 
Audacy has a lot of underperforming properties in SF. KGMZ and KRBQ live on the bottom end! I don’t think Alice and Live listeners share much in common. Adult contemporary is just a saturated format in the bay, plus KEZR is hot competition in the South Bay, so Alice already had less room to break in over KOIT, KIOI and KEZR. Not to mention the very soft AC KISQ.
